Lot title: Antique British Sterling Silver Lucifer Matchbox Holder – Birmingham, ca. 1910-1930
Description: Offered is a beautiful and elegant antique lucifer/matchbox holder (matchbox cover) made from solid British silver. This luxurious desktop accessory dates from the early 20th century (Edwardian / early Art Deco period) and was designed to stylishly clad a standard cardboard matchbox. The holder features a very fine, refined vertical line pattern (engine-turned / guilloché decoration) all around. Thanks to the handy cutouts on the sides, the striking surface of the box remains perfectly accessible, while the oval openings at the top and bottom make it easy to slide the inner box open.
On the underside the object is stamped with a complete and official set of traditional British silver hallmarks:
Anchor: City mark of the Birmingham Assay Office.
Lion Passant: Legal guarantee for first-rate (.925) sterling silver.
Date Letter: Wear/mark appropriate to the early 20th century.
Mastermark: Maker's mark (partly worn) above the hallmarks.
A splendid and authentic collectible for enthusiasts of antique silver and unique smoking accessories.
Specifications:
Object: Lucifer matchbox holder / Matchbox cover
Material: Solid Sterling Silver (.925)
Origin: Birmingham, United Kingdom
Period: ca. 1910 - 1930
Decoration: Vertical line pattern (guilloché / engine-turned)
Condition: Good antique condition with light, characteristic signs of aging and superficial oxidation/patina (easily polished to a high gloss). No major dents or cracks.
